Ridden PRE Geldings, 4 Yrs +
Info:
Open to all PRE horses registered with BAPSH in Reg I only. Dress code is English tack and attire - please read the showing guide on our website. Judge will be looking for the best riding horse, judged on quality of paces, manners and obedience, conformation and type. There will be group walk, trot and canter on both reins. An individual show will be required and must not exceed 1.5 minutes and include walk, trot and canter, halt and rein back. Judge may require horses to be stripped.

Horses 1. All UK entries must be registered in the UK under correct ownership, and in the case of entries into ANCCE classes, horses must also be correctly registered with ANCCE. Visiting horses from outside of the UK to compete in the ANCCE classes must be correctly registered with ANCCE via their relevant country. Invited breeds must be registered with their relevant breed society. 2. All horses must be accompanied by their passport, which must be available for inspection on request. 3. Horses must have their Equine Influenza vaccination up to date. 4. Horses present at the show must be in good health and body condition, and sound. If a horse is deemed to be unsuitable for competition by the Competition Vet the owner will be asked to withdraw the horse from the class. The Competition Vet’s decision is final. 5. All ridden horses must be 4yrs old and over. 6. Horses under inadequate control or whose riders/handlers cannot keep them in a manner acceptable to the judge /officials/other competitors will be asked to leave the ring at the judge’s discretion, and may also be asked to leave the showground. 7. All Serreta halters and in-hand show halters/bridles must have an attached throat lash and fit the horse’s head correctly. 8. Horses must be kept to a walk around the horsebox parking area, and around the stable area. 9. Horses must not be kept on lorries overnight 10. Horses must not be tied to the outside of a lorry.
